  • Patent number: 10132882
    Abstract: A body coil support structure includes an elongate support member. The elongate support member defines an opening and an examination axis passing through the opening along a length of the elongate support member. The opening is configured to accept an object to be imaged. The elongate support member has a target shape for use during operation of the MRI system, with the elongate support member configured to be subjected to an operational load during operation. In a design state, the elongate support member defines a design shape, with the elongate support member not subjected to the operational load in the design state. In an installed state after installation in the MRI system, the elongate support member defines an operational shape. The elongate support member is subjected to the operational load in the installed state. The operational shape is closer to the target shape than is the design shape.

  • Patent number: 10133768
    Abstract: The creation of transaction segment records that are each associated with transaction segments within a log that includes multiple tasks, each of at least some associated with a corresponding transaction. The transaction segment records each include a transaction identifier set that define which tasks are included within the transaction segment. The transaction identifier sets are non-overlapping such that the transaction segments may be processed substantially in parallel by dispatching the transaction segment records to different worker threads. The identity of a latest external dependee entity, if any, is included within the transaction segment record. Upon being assigned a transaction segment for processing, the module assigned the transaction segment awaits completion of processing of the latest external dependee entity prior to processing the transaction segment.

  • Patent number: 10134258
    Abstract: Improvements in an abandoned baby, infant, child or animal alter system is disclosed. When a child or animal is being transported with a driver in the vehicle, the driver will generally maintain a comfortable temperature in the interior of the vehicle. The temperature and temperature changes are monitored to determine that a child or animal is unattended. The monitor is coupled with a connection in the car, a seat belt of a baby seat or integrated into the baby seat. Integrating the sensor with a seat belt or buckle provides a switch for operation of the sensor. The signaling system can be integrated with the light, horn or alarm or can be connected to a cellular network, Wi-Fi or other radio communications system to send a notification that a baby, infant, child or animal has been left and secured in a vehicle and needs attention.

  • Patent number: 10135826
    Abstract: A method of leveraging security-as-a-service for cloud-based file sharing includes receiving, at a cloud-based file sharing server external to an enterprise network and having connectivity to the enterprise network, instructions from an enterprise network to validate a file uploaded by a first user associated with the enterprise network before allowing the file to be downloaded. The file sharing server may then receive the file from the first user and forward the file to a cloud-based security-as-a-service (SECaaS) server that is also external to the enterprise network and has connectivity to the enterprise network. The file sharing server receives a determination of validation from the cloud-based SECaaS server and allows a second user to download the file based on the determination. To make the determination, the SECaaS server retrieves cryptographic keying material from a cloud-based key management server, and decrypts the file.

  • Patent number: 10131568
    Abstract: The present invention provides a method for synthesizing high optical quality multicomponent chalcogenide glasses without refractive index perturbations due to striae, phase separation or crystal formation using a two-zone furnace and multiple fining steps. The top and bottom zones are initially heated to the same temperature, and then a temperature gradient is created between the top zone and the bottom zone. The fining and cooling phase is divided into multiple steps with multiple temperature holds.
